Here's a scare headline if I've ever seen one. "U. of Texas becomes the latest institution to clear out a main library to make room for computers." Oh no, they're getting rid of books! Well, not exactly - they're just moving them to another facility. Of course, the main message in this piece from the Chronicle is that "Critics worry that all of the money and attention being spent on digital libraries leaves less money for books, and that the days when a scholar could spend hours wandering through the stacks." Sheesh. But hey, it's the Chronicle - let's ramp up the silly rhetoric: "I think it's ridiculous," she says of the plan to empty out nearly all the volumes. "I don't see how you can replace books."
